                 as well - Shortcut Spaghetti with Meat Sauce
                 This recipe is from my All Against Grain cookbook- Danielle Walker
                 Ingredients-
                 2 tsp ghee or extra virgin olive oil (I get my ghee at Trader Joes)
                 4 cloves garlic, minced                                  2 pounds ground beef
                 1 tbsp Italian seasoning                                 1 tbsp dried parsley
                 2 tsp onion powder                                        1 1/2 tsp sea salt
                 1/2 tsp cracked black pepper                         1/2 tsp crushed red pepper
                 5 cups spaghetti sauce (either store bought or make your own)
                 Pasta of choice (I will use spaghetti squash for my noodles sometimes!)
                 Directions- 
                 1.  Heat the ghee in a saucepan over medium-high heat. Saute the garlic for 1 minute, until
                      fragrant. Add the beef and seasonings, reduce the heat to medium, and cook for 10
                      minutes, until the beef is cooked through. Drain any grease.
                2.   Pour in the spaghetti sauce and simmer for 10 minutes. Serve over pasta or pasta
                      substitute of your choice.
